Många Windows-användare är så vana vid det grafiska gränssnittet och webbläsaren som det universella valet att de glömmer att det finns en mängd andra verktyg där ute. Wget är ett GNU-kommandoradsverktyg som är populärt främst i Linux- och Unix-gemenskaperna, främst för att ladda ner filer från internet. Det finns dock en version av wget för Windows, och med den kan du ladda ner vad du vill, från hela webbplatser till filmer, musik, podcaster och stora filer från var som helst online.
Inte många Microsoft-användare känner till detta snygga verktyg, varför jag skrev den här nybörjarguiden för att använda wget i Windows. Vi brukar använda vår webbläsare till allt, vilket är bra men det är inte alltid det mest effektiva sättet att uppnå något. Wget är bara ett av de många verktyg som har funnits i evigheter men väldigt få människor känner till.
Hämta wget för Windows
Att få wget är väldigt enkelt. Följ den här guiden för att installera och konfigurera wget.
- Ladda ner wget härifrån och installera det. Se till att det är installationsprogrammet och inte bara källan annars fungerar det inte.
- När det väl är installerat bör du nu kunna komma åt kommandot wget från ett kommandoradsfönster. Öppna ett CMD-fönster som administratör och skriv 'wget -h' för att testa. Om det fungerar är du gyllene, om du får "okänt kommando" laddade du ner fel paket. Försök igen.
- Ställ in en nedladdningskatalog för att spara alla dina filer. Skriv "md katalognamn" för att skapa en nedladdningskatalog. Jag kallade min "downloadz" för att vara igenkännbar.
När du har installerat är du redo att börja arbeta. Nedan har jag listat ett urval av populära wget-kommandon som kan uppnå en mängd olika saker.
Ladda ner en enda fil
wget //website.com/file.zip
Ladda ner en enskild fil men spara den som något annat
wget ‐‐output-document=newname.html website.com
Ladda ner till en specifik mapp
wget ‐‐directory-prefix=mapp/undermapp website.com/file.zip
Återuppta en avbruten nedladdning
wget ‐‐continue website.com /file.zip
Ladda ner en nyare version av en fil
wget ‐‐fortsätt ‐‐tidsstämpla website.com/file.zip
Ladda ner flera webbsidor
För detta behöver du skapa en lista i Anteckningar eller annan textredigerare. Lägg till en ny fullständig URL (med //) på en separat rad. Peka sedan wget på filen. I det här exemplet namngav jag filen Filelist.txt och sparade den i mappen wget.
wget ‐‐input Filelist.txt
Ladda ner en hel webbplats
wget ‐‐execute robots=off ‐‐rekursiv ‐‐ingen förälder ‐‐fortsätt ‐‐no-clobber //website.com
Du kanske upptäcker, som jag ofta gör, att webbvärdar blockerar wget-kommandon. Du kan försöka förfalska dessa block genom att imitera Googlebot. Testa att skriva detta:
wget –user-agent=”Googlebot/2.1 (+//www.googlebot.com/bot.html)” -r //website.com
Ladda ner en specifik filtyp från en webbplats
wget ‐‐level=1 ‐‐rekursiv ‐‐ingen förälder ‐‐acceptera FILETYPE //website.com / FILETYPE/
Ändra till exempel FILTYP mot MP3, MP4, .zip eller vad du vill.
Ladda ner alla bilder på webbplatsen
wget ‐‐directory-prefix=filer/bilder ‐‐inga kataloger ‐‐rekursiv ‐‐no-clobber ‐‐acceptera jpg,gif,png,jpeg //website.com/images/
Kontrollera en webbplats för trasiga länkar
wget ‐‐output-fil=logfile.txt ‐‐rekursiv ‐‐spindel //website.com
Ladda ner filer utan att överbelasta webbservern
wget ‐‐limit-rate=20k ‐‐wait=60 ‐‐random-wait ‐‐mirror //website.com
Det finns hundratals, om inte tusentals wget-kommandon och jag har bara visat dig några av dem här. Nu när du är bekant med verktyget och hur det fungerar, är det upp till dig vad du använder det till!
Har du några coola kommandon som kan åstadkomma underverk? Dela dem med oss nedan!